Kingspan Completes 881-kW Rooftop Solar Installation at Illinois Manufacturing Facility

881-kilowatt system expected to generate 1 million kilowatt-hours of renewable electricity annually
April 17, 2026

Kingspan Insulation North America celebrated the completion of a new rooftop solar installation at its Mendota manufacturing facility with a ribbon-cutting event alongside project partners REC Solar and Dynamic Energy.

FCA Leads Design for SUNY Delhi’s New $40M Applied Technology Facility

Set to open in 2029, the new 30,000-square-foot facility will significantly expand hands-on training opportunities
February 5, 2026

FCA announces the firm will lead the transformation of SUNY Delhi’s North Hall into a state-of-the-art Applied Technology Facility, following Governor Kathy Hochul’s announcement of a $40 million investment to advance advanced manufacturing training across the region.

Duro-Last Expands Texas Operations with Move to New Dallas Facility

The Dallas site offers 130,000 square feet of modernized space, an increase of more than 40% compared the existing location
August 1, 2025

Duro-Last announced the expansion of its Texas operations with plans to transition from its current Carrollton, Texas, location to a larger, upgraded facility in Dallas.

GAF Breaks Ground on New State-of-the-Art Facility

New facility to boost local economy, expand GAF’s national manufacturing footprint, and support long-term community partnerships in Harvey County
June 6, 2025

GAF announced that construction has begun on its new, world-class shingle manufacturing facility in Newton, Kansas.
